- What is Camden Property Trust's buildings and improvements?
- Camden Property Trust (CPT) reported buildings and improvements of $11.8B in Q1 2026.
- How has Camden Property Trust's buildings and improvements changed year-over-year?
- Camden Property Trust's buildings and improvements increased by 2.2% year-over-year, from $11.55B to $11.8B.
- What is the long-term trend for Camden Property Trust's buildings and improvements?
-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Camden Property Trust's buildings and improvements has grown at a 8.7%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$7.76B to $11.79B.
- What does buildings and improvements mean?
- The historical cost of all buildings and structural improvements owned by the company.
- How do you interpret buildings and improvements?
- Increases reflect capital expenditure on new construction or major renovations, while decreases reflect asset sales.
- How does buildings and improvements compare across companies?
- Commonly reported by all property-owning entities to track the gross value of physical infrastructure.
